The third week of July, I was extremely blessed to be able to head to a much needed retreat at Brackenhurst Retreat Center, just outside of Nairobi. This 4 days of rest, relaxation, pampering, and spiritual encouragement was provided by a wonderful organization called Christian Hospitality Network and CFC church in TN. CHN was started to provide R&R for missionaries around the world. They have it down to an art! When we arrived, we were greeted with true southern hospitality and given goody bags prepared especially for each one of us by the person who had paid for us to be there. Then we were told about all the free things we could take advantage of - medical care, a chiropracter, massages, haircuts and various excursions we could choose from. The excursion I chose was a visit to a tea plantation. This was the main house - very British colonial

The beautiful lawn where we had a wonderful 4-course lunch

The tea fields were so pretty. Each worker gets 6 shillings (less than 10 cents) for each kilo of leaves they pick. Their daily goal is 100 kilos!
